How to Use Cat Cephalexin Dosage Calculator

The Cat Cephalexin Dosage Calculator helps you translate vet mg/kg orders into capsules, tablets or mL per dose.

  1. Confirm the prescription — Typical cat cephalexin dose: 15–30 mg/kg every 8–12 hours.
  2. Enter weight and mg/kg — Use the latest clinic weight.
  3. Pick the product form — Liquid suspension is easier for cats under 4 kg.
  4. Use a syringe or pill pocket — Cats can refuse meds — wet food, churu or pill pockets help compliance.

Formula & Theory — Cat Cephalexin Dosage Calculator

Dosing follows the standard weight × mg/kg formula:

dose_mg = weight_kg × mg_per_kg
volume_mL = dose_mg ÷ concentration_mg_per_mL
units = dose_mg ÷ tablet_strength_mg
daily_total = dose_mg × doses_per_day

Use Cases for Cat Cephalexin Dosage Calculator

Skin infections, abscesses, lower urinary tract infections, post-surgical infection prophylaxis, or stomatitis follow-up.

Frequently asked questions about Cat Cephalexin Dosage Calculator

Can I split capsules?

Capsule contents are bitter and dose-inaccurate when split. Switch to liquid for half-doses.

What if my cat misses a dose?

Give it as soon as you remember unless it's nearly time for the next dose; never double up.

Are side effects common?

Vomiting and soft stools are the most common. Giving with food helps GI tolerance.

Can I use my dog's cephalexin?

Same drug, but always verify the mg/kg dose and shelf life with your vet first.
